Cheeseburger Soup

Creamy, cheesy, and beefy...all the things that make the best soup to warm up on a cold day.
The first time I made this recipe it was actually supposed to be taco soup. Well, I started making the soup and realized I didn't have all the ingredients needed to make a true taco soup. So, it turned into my own version of Cheeseburger Soup. It turned into the BEST cooking mistake ever!
Ingredients
- 1 lb of Back Forty Ground Beef
- 1 lb of Velveeta Cheese
- 1 10 oz can of Cream Corn
- 2 10 oz cans of Rotel
- 2 10 oz cans of French Onion Soup
- Brown hamburger and drain any grease.
- While the hamburger is browning, cube up the Velveeta Cheese.
- Once the cheese is cubed, mix it into the crockpot along with the Cream Corn, Rotel, and French Onion Soup.
- Add hamburger once browned.
- Cook on low for 4 hours or on high for two hours stirring occasionally.
